A leadership development program is a crucial component for the success of any organization. It is a structured and systematic approach to grooming and nurturing current and future leaders within an organization. This program aims to enhance the leadership skills and capabilities of individuals at all levels, from entry-level employees to senior executives. The ultimate goal of a leadership development program is to create a pipeline of skilled and effective leaders who can drive the organization forward in a constantly evolving business landscape.
There are several key benefits to implementing a leadership development program within an organization. Firstly, it helps to identify and nurture high-potential employees who have the ability to take on greater responsibilities and leadership roles in the future. By providing these individuals with specific training and development opportunities, organizations can ensure that they are well-prepared to step into leadership positions when the time arises.
Furthermore, a leadership development program can help to improve overall employee engagement and morale. When employees see that their organization is invested in their growth and development, they are more likely to feel valued and motivated to perform at their best. This can lead to increased productivity, higher job satisfaction, and lower turnover rates within the organization.
Additionally, a leadership development program can help to create a culture of continuous learning and improvement within an organization. By providing employees with ongoing training and development opportunities, organizations can foster a growth mindset and encourage individuals to constantly seek out ways to improve their skills and abilities. This can lead to increased innovation, better decision-making, and a more adaptable workforce that is better equipped to navigate change and uncertainty.
There are many different components that can be included in a leadership development program, depending on the needs and goals of the organization. Some common elements of a successful program may include mentoring and coaching, leadership training workshops, executive education programs, job rotations, and stretch assignments. By providing a mix of formal and informal learning opportunities, organizations can help to develop a well-rounded and versatile group of leaders who are capable of tackling a wide range of challenges.
It is important for organizations to approach the design and implementation of a leadership development program with a strategic mindset. The program should be aligned with the overall business objectives of the organization and should be tailored to meet the specific needs of the individuals participating in the program. By taking a targeted and personalized approach, organizations can ensure that their leadership development program is effective and impactful in developing the next generation of leaders.
